Start your day at the iconic Gateway of India, a monumental arch overlooking the Arabian Sea. Built during the British Raj, this historical landmark offers stunning views and is a popular gathering place for locals and tourists alike. Spend some time taking in the architecture and enjoying the sea breeze. (Free admission, 1 hour)
Take a ferry ride from the Gateway of India to the Elephanta Caves, a UNESCO World Heritage Site located on Elephanta Island. Explore the ancient rock-cut temples dedicated to Lord Shiva, marvel at the intricate sculptures, and learn about the rich history and mythology behind them. (Ferry cost: approximately INR 200 per person, Entrance fee: INR 40 per person, 3 hours)
Head to Sanjay Gandhi National Park, a lush forest reserve within the city limits. Embark on an adventurous trek or opt for a thrilling safari to spot wildlife like leopards, deer, and monkeys. Enjoy the serene surroundings, visit the Kanheri Caves, and take a boat ride on the park's lake. (Entrance fee: INR 53 per person, Safari cost: INR 200 per person, 4 hours)
End your day at Juhu Beach, one of Mumbai's most popular beaches. Take a leisurely stroll along the shoreline, watch the mesmerizing sunset, and indulge in some local street food specialties like pav bhaji and bhelpuri. You can also try various adventure activities such as parasailing or horse riding. (Free admission, 2 hours)
If you're looking for more adventure, consider exploring the Aksa Beach in Malad, which offers a tranquil escape from the bustling city. For adrenaline junkies, there's Della Adventure Park in Lonavala, just a couple of hours away from Mumbai, where you can try thrilling activities like ziplining, rappelling, and rock climbing.
